Advanced Metering Infrastructure (AMI)

Advanced Metering Infrastructure (AMI), is the complete automation of the metering process which includes meter reading, distribution monitoring and remote control for connection and disconnect

Mi.Hydrant supports the relay of data to & from other Mi.Node & Mi.Hydrant units.

1. Data collected from water meters are temporarily stored in the Mi.Node unit’s internal memory.

2. The Mi.Node unit transmits readings, leak, backflow, tamper & alarm data to Mi.Hydrant.

3. Mi.Hydrant transmits the data to the Mi.Hub collector.

Mi.Hydrant-- How it Works

Engineered routes between nodes• Nodes can all connect to each

other via multiple hops• Self-healing = very reliable• Up to four data paths to Collector

Multi-Path Networking

In a star network environment, communication signals are transmitted from each meter to the receiver and then to the utility.

Star Networking
